summaryrefslogtreecommitdiff
path: root/dev-util/rosinstall_generator
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
committerV3n3RiX <venerix@redcorelinux.org>2020-08-25 10:45:55 +0100
commit3cf7c3ef441822c889356fd1812ebf2944a59851 (patch)
treec513fe68548b40365c1c2ebfe35c58ad431cdd77 /dev-util/rosinstall_generator
parent05b8b0e0af1d72e51a3ee61522941bf7605cd01c (diff)
gentoo resync : 25.08.2020
Diffstat (limited to 'dev-util/rosinstall_generator')
-rw-r--r--dev-util/rosinstall_generator/Manifest9
-rw-r--r--dev-util/rosinstall_generator/files/yaml.patch13
-rw-r--r--dev-util/rosinstall_generator/rosinstall_generator-0.1.13.ebuild35
-rw-r--r--dev-util/rosinstall_generator/rosinstall_generator-0.1.22.ebuild (renamed from dev-util/rosinstall_generator/rosinstall_generator-0.1.14.ebuild)7
-rw-r--r--dev-util/rosinstall_generator/rosinstall_generator-9999.ebuild7
5 files changed, 25 insertions, 46 deletions
diff --git a/dev-util/rosinstall_generator/Manifest b/dev-util/rosinstall_generator/Manifest
index de563fa510e7..c5c000fced36 100644
--- a/dev-util/rosinstall_generator/Manifest
+++ b/dev-util/rosinstall_generator/Manifest
@@ -1,6 +1,5 @@
-DIST rosinstall_generator-0.1.13.tar.gz 11186 BLAKE2B bb6f95eba12ee6b9adfa22d46475d555aa9b3bed225e3be52a52f380bbd1ab3f86871a9a816c56c874f8545d2ef648e226ad5d8d3346444a92202865265260f1 SHA512 c8b5736066f8a42a324b2bed578e03282b6d8ae8df48fb30545617c2995ce53f35d7fea6fab3989383b958e7cb763b24deb67c5ec3496cc77f1ba51f110ab78c
-DIST rosinstall_generator-0.1.14.tar.gz 11419 BLAKE2B af9754f46589aac1e9bb265345319c4037d2b1e10ea8119859e2715b2828974bc4422cac25f84216c401f35b7cddde207e7562afb07e753328940db347b69a20 SHA512 45461917afaf93f38b118951c272ba71a408d2c276b4019739c9c8dc9407812bf166bb762910ce45cedc9b31e2796922a69681ad461c468c7ed2372a1d189904
-EBUILD rosinstall_generator-0.1.13.ebuild 927 BLAKE2B 740ba1c9f92b57910520ea268c5b750f4386644abee085671fcb18bd2d6dd9e3d9570e8936350e58cd3fd3357b95e5367970c83d7fac31ff7d09416eb60b4683 SHA512 e5fec4e1c60fb18156644ff02e0067eec142f316a7ec0265e975884a6b8618b238a061f87f489eeaff5e77827b203263173fae162285f0bcdb37658215a88375
-EBUILD rosinstall_generator-0.1.14.ebuild 1062 BLAKE2B f3775ef7c5961166c60dd37622bb6f24eed6b57c7893779686a161352e535f9e19ad0859ad27c8687bed21d5daed2a6b60cc676aeb607f04429d841660a9bd73 SHA512 82b38f11458e58c7fa269ed5c20a225148f0008f61d7e4fb2ebbc5388720d5258d45b0f708e3b0b1acfbf4d95fd5786afb49b44b2b8c56c9f5ca9080f29a3445
-EBUILD rosinstall_generator-9999.ebuild 1062 BLAKE2B f3775ef7c5961166c60dd37622bb6f24eed6b57c7893779686a161352e535f9e19ad0859ad27c8687bed21d5daed2a6b60cc676aeb607f04429d841660a9bd73 SHA512 82b38f11458e58c7fa269ed5c20a225148f0008f61d7e4fb2ebbc5388720d5258d45b0f708e3b0b1acfbf4d95fd5786afb49b44b2b8c56c9f5ca9080f29a3445
+AUX yaml.patch 493 BLAKE2B ce0d917dc54edda1423b29c1f39662c56e6be8b0c33012cc8cbb8a86b4fe20c9a25139ed2b59db9aca245ebae01a7a1f06f4956a8521bc046ffd46ed795752c9 SHA512 d63da158e7a496da2de41bbfe453e492cd32b9380b11f3201491fc40bc6a9f4057adc19ce0ce7e417080bb9ded0010790caf69d7cd50373cd53033f37a42c456
+DIST rosinstall_generator-0.1.22.tar.gz 11902 BLAKE2B 6dd41c8b86146a9e50d4a20fd4991ed247de915d29f051c6dc416b6820386497ccf3a9cf6dde16e039932c354d7dfc5b6706bc206c16b068633fbddb69686452 SHA512 c1801ea441d1765090684a12e559a39ce496d08f91021b13d026a4127e5bc16974daa2cb561f0ed6c54a31216f57c1f3e257b4a96aec8255c34b37c5545123c6
+EBUILD rosinstall_generator-0.1.22.ebuild 1100 BLAKE2B 975af506b78a86e7f6e7bef81e5ceef0d66d8becf9fef3c7541a9e74fcf269a6abb1030559ddd2d22f3826813e42c2270915b1790ec4f80d06de1fb6f077c05d SHA512 1efbb4fc3109308401ad998e20ca66abb6223fc04a5796a5dd0dac755da0eedc6c66f0f93c3b9259e6ff64a75e1d79c328163b2b52b6f4f68a43339e82ddf7ed
+EBUILD rosinstall_generator-9999.ebuild 1100 BLAKE2B 975af506b78a86e7f6e7bef81e5ceef0d66d8becf9fef3c7541a9e74fcf269a6abb1030559ddd2d22f3826813e42c2270915b1790ec4f80d06de1fb6f077c05d SHA512 1efbb4fc3109308401ad998e20ca66abb6223fc04a5796a5dd0dac755da0eedc6c66f0f93c3b9259e6ff64a75e1d79c328163b2b52b6f4f68a43339e82ddf7ed
MISC metadata.xml 353 BLAKE2B 26692ca3eb76500607275909a9c86bc88f7c80114e7840763136902a59dddc8f23dcd766f821aa5beffff9419d39a48e18682f86c8148df7d640977c9b30ebcd SHA512 a681a9f31c4cf06a775ef57f7a942c76d0e8873c4c854fddaf44df0301f3e14bd836727e6816bc74f0ced9e54dfd9335c376c47b8af2a19455c42a3f6ed38a18
diff --git a/dev-util/rosinstall_generator/files/yaml.patch b/dev-util/rosinstall_generator/files/yaml.patch
new file mode 100644
index 000000000000..668e1ef58b71
--- /dev/null
+++ b/dev-util/rosinstall_generator/files/yaml.patch
@@ -0,0 +1,13 @@
+Index: rosinstall_generator-0.1.22/test/test_distro.py
+===================================================================
+--- rosinstall_generator-0.1.22.orig/test/test_distro.py
++++ rosinstall_generator-0.1.22/test/test_distro.py
+@@ -53,7 +53,7 @@ def _get_test_dist():
+ type: distribution
+ version: 2
+ '''
+- return DistributionFile('test', yaml.load(test_dist_yaml))
++ return DistributionFile('test', yaml.safe_load(test_dist_yaml))
+
+
+ def test_get_package_names():
diff --git a/dev-util/rosinstall_generator/rosinstall_generator-0.1.13.ebuild b/dev-util/rosinstall_generator/rosinstall_generator-0.1.13.ebuild
deleted file mode 100644
index 7419030810a4..000000000000
--- a/dev-util/rosinstall_generator/rosinstall_generator-0.1.13.ebuild
+++ /dev/null
@@ -1,35 +0,0 @@
-# Copyright 1999-2020 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=5
-PYTHON_COMPAT=( python3_6 )
-
-SCM=""
-if [ "${PV#9999}" != "${PV}" ] ; then
- SCM="git-r3"
- EGIT_REPO_URI="https://github.com/ros-infrastructure/rosinstall_generator"
-fi
-
-inherit ${SCM} distutils-r1
-
-DESCRIPTION="Generates rosinstall metadata about repositories with ROS packages/stacks"
-HOMEPAGE="http://wiki.ros.org/rosinstall_generator"
-if [ "${PV#9999}" != "${PV}" ] ; then
- SRC_URI=""
- KEYWORDS=""
-else
- SRC_URI="https://github.com/ros-infrastructure/rosinstall_generator/archive/${PV}.tar.gz -> ${P}.tar.gz"
- KEYWORDS="~amd64 ~arm"
-fi
-
-LICENSE="BSD"
-SLOT="0"
-IUSE=""
-
-RDEPEND="
- >=dev-python/catkin_pkg-0.1.28[${PYTHON_USEDEP}]
- >=dev-python/rosdistro-0.5.0[${PYTHON_USEDEP}]
- dev-python/rospkg[${PYTHON_USEDEP}]
- dev-python/pyyaml[${PYTHON_USEDEP}]"
-DEPEND="${RDEPEND}
- dev-python/setuptools[${PYTHON_USEDEP}]"
diff --git a/dev-util/rosinstall_generator/rosinstall_generator-0.1.14.ebuild b/dev-util/rosinstall_generator/rosinstall_generator-0.1.22.ebuild
index 2b89625c44ca..58ee6bf23a0d 100644
--- a/dev-util/rosinstall_generator/rosinstall_generator-0.1.14.ebuild
+++ b/dev-util/rosinstall_generator/rosinstall_generator-0.1.22.ebuild
@@ -1,8 +1,8 @@
# Copyright 1999-2020 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=5
-PYTHON_COMPAT=( python3_6 pypy3 )
+EAPI=7
+PYTHON_COMPAT=( python3_{6,7,8} )
SCM=""
if [ "${PV#9999}" != "${PV}" ] ; then
@@ -13,7 +13,7 @@ fi
inherit ${SCM} distutils-r1
DESCRIPTION="Generates rosinstall metadata about repositories with ROS packages/stacks"
-HOMEPAGE="http://wiki.ros.org/rosinstall_generator"
+HOMEPAGE="https://wiki.ros.org/rosinstall_generator"
if [ "${PV#9999}" != "${PV}" ] ; then
SRC_URI=""
KEYWORDS=""
@@ -35,6 +35,7 @@ RDEPEND="
DEPEND="${RDEPEND}
dev-python/setuptools[${PYTHON_USEDEP}]
test? ( dev-python/nose[${PYTHON_USEDEP}] )"
+PATCHES=( "${FILESDIR}/yaml.patch" )
python_test() {
nosetests --with-coverage || die
diff --git a/dev-util/rosinstall_generator/rosinstall_generator-9999.ebuild b/dev-util/rosinstall_generator/rosinstall_generator-9999.ebuild
index 2b89625c44ca..58ee6bf23a0d 100644
--- a/dev-util/rosinstall_generator/rosinstall_generator-9999.ebuild
+++ b/dev-util/rosinstall_generator/rosinstall_generator-9999.ebuild
@@ -1,8 +1,8 @@
# Copyright 1999-2020 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=5
-PYTHON_COMPAT=( python3_6 pypy3 )
+EAPI=7
+PYTHON_COMPAT=( python3_{6,7,8} )
SCM=""
if [ "${PV#9999}" != "${PV}" ] ; then
@@ -13,7 +13,7 @@ fi
inherit ${SCM} distutils-r1
DESCRIPTION="Generates rosinstall metadata about repositories with ROS packages/stacks"
-HOMEPAGE="http://wiki.ros.org/rosinstall_generator"
+HOMEPAGE="https://wiki.ros.org/rosinstall_generator"
if [ "${PV#9999}" != "${PV}" ] ; then
SRC_URI=""
KEYWORDS=""
@@ -35,6 +35,7 @@ RDEPEND="
DEPEND="${RDEPEND}
dev-python/setuptools[${PYTHON_USEDEP}]
test? ( dev-python/nose[${PYTHON_USEDEP}] )"
+PATCHES=( "${FILESDIR}/yaml.patch" )
python_test() {
nosetests --with-coverage || die